https://gcc.gnu.org/bugzilla/show_bug.cgi?id=66824

--- Comment #3 from uros at gcc dot gnu.org ---
Author: uros
Date: Fri Jul 17 07:02:29 2015
New Revision: 225919

URL: https://gcc.gnu.org/viewcvs?rev=225919&root=gcc&view=rev
Log:
        PR target/66824
        * config/i386/i386.h (TARGET_HARD_SF_REGS): New define.
        (TARGET_HARD_DF_REGS): Ditto.
        (TARGET_HARD_XF_REGS): Ditto.
        * config/i386/i386.md (*movxf_internal): Add alternatives 9 and 10.
        Enable alternatives 9 and 10 only for !TARGET_HARD_XF_REG target.
        (*movdf_internal): Add alternatives 22, 23, 24 and 25. Enable
        alternatives 22, 23, 24 and 25 only for !TARGET_HARD_DF_REG target.
        (*movsf_internal): Add alternatives 16 and 17. Enable
        alternatives 16 and 17 only for !TARGET_HARD_SF_REG target.


Modified:
    trunk/gcc/ChangeLog
    trunk/gcc/config/i386/i386.h
    trunk/gcc/config/i386/i386.md

Reply via email to